Neuroscience Territory Account Specialist - Los Angeles
Novartis Group CompaniesVentura, California, United StatesThis is a field-based and remote opportunity supporting key accounts in an assigned geography.Novartis is unable to offer relocation support for this role.Please only apply if this location is acce...Show more